Title: The Innovative Mind of Alexander Charles Knill

Introduction:

Alexander Charles Knill is a brilliant inventor based in Cambridge, GB, with a remarkable track record of 21 patents to his name. His groundbreaking work in the field of inductive power transfer systems has revolutionized the way power is transferred wirelessly.

Latest Patents:

One of Knill's latest patents involves a sophisticated system for controlling inductive power transfer systems. This system effectively detects and manages power discrepancies between the primary unit and secondary devices, ensuring efficient and reliable power transfer without the need for direct electrical contacts.
